COMMUNITY NEWS

  • The City of Lubbock and Texas Tech will host a free back to school bash on Wednesday from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m. at the Lubbock Memorial Civic Center — the event will give out 5,000 backpacks and school supplies to students in kindergarten to 12th grade and offer free haircuts along with community resources.  FOX34
  • The city of Lubbock has released the full week of public library events starting July 28 with shows, storytimes, crafts, and a Back-2-School Bash at branches like Mahon, Patterson, Godeke, and Groves. The programs serve all ages (from young children to seniors) and include a summer reading challenge that runs through July 31.  KLBK
  • Dairy Queen in Lubbock will host Miracle Treat Day on July 31 to support Children’s Miracle Network Hospitals—each Blizzard Treat purchased will donate at least $1 to fund pediatric care.  KLBK

ACCIDENTS NEWS

  • On the evening of July 28 at approximately 7:54 p.m., emergency crews responded to a fire on East 19th Street in Lubbock and brought it under control—no injuries were reported as the Texas State Fire Marshal’s Office investigated the cause.  KLBK

BUSINESS NEWS

  • Taco Villa will open a new store at 3428 Milwaukee Avenue on July 31st with a ribbon cutting at 2 p.m. — the event will offer free milkshake samples, a debut of BBQ Chicken Nachos and a chance to win VIP tickets to Rock the Hill.  FOX34
  • The Spins—named after a Mac Miller track that sparked owner Evelyn Mendez’s inspiration—will open during Lubbock's First Friday Art Trail in August at 1947 19th Street, offering soulful coffees, homemade syrups, fresh tamales, and community events in a cozy space lined with vinyl records and art.  KLBK
  • Taco Villa announced a new store at 3428 Milwaukee Avenue and will host a grand opening on Thursday, July 31 starting at 2:00 p.m. The event will offer free milkshake samples (their debut), a chance to win VIP tickets to Rock the Hill and other prizes, marking the brand’s first new store in over six years.  KLBK

CRIME NEWS

  • Officers responded to a shots fired call near Baylor and North University in north Lubbock early Monday—one person was taken to UMC and later died with no details yet on the cause.  KCBD
